Meteorological Summary:
  • Mostly dry conditions expected statewide today and tonight as an area of high pressure remains centered over the Sunshine State (near 0% chance of rain).
  • High temperatures in the 70s statewide.
  • Winds will reach up to 10 mph with gusts up to 15 mph.
  • Dry air will continue to linger across the state will allow for sensitive to locally elevated wildfire conditionsthis afternoon and evening.
  • The wildfire over southern Miami-Dade County may continue to create hazy conditions due to smoke.
  • Low to moderate risk for rip currents returns statewide with relatively calm marine conditions; locally high risk for rip currentsin Palm Beach County.
  • Low temperatures in the 40s across North Florida, low to middle 50s across Central Florida, middle 50s to middle 60s across South Florida, and upper 60s to low 70s along the Keys.
  • Areas of patchy fog may be possible along the Florida Panhandle overnight into early Sunday morning.
